The governor of the Yemeni city of Aden and a minister in the government survived an assassination attempt after their convoy was targeted by a car bomb in the city of Tawahi.
According to security sources, the explosion that targeted the convoy of Aden Governor Ahmed Lamlas and Minister of Agriculture Salem Al Saqari in the government left five dead and many injured.
Howver, both the officials were not hurt.
Yemeni Prime Minister Maeen Abdul-Malik, called both the leaders separately to inquire about their health.
Both leaders confirmed that they were in good condition and that no harm had affected them.
Prime Minister has tasked the competent authorities to conduct an urgent investigation into the circumstances of the terrorist operation, and to strengthen security vigilance in the country.
